Menla Tire Center & Auto Repair

Andrew Heathcote

Menla Tire Center & Auto Repair

Repair mcallen Tire retailer Mobile tire repair service in mcallen tx menla tire center & auto repair

Mobile Tire Repair Service in McAllen TX | Mobile Mechanic of McAllen

Tire world car care center :: mandeville la tires & auto repair shop Tire care center car world contact

Mobile Tire Repair Service in McAllen TX | Mobile Mechanic of McAllen
Mobile Tire Repair Service in McAllen TX | Mobile Mechanic of McAllen
Tire World Car Care Center :: Mandeville LA Tires & Auto Repair Shop
Tire World Car Care Center :: Mandeville LA Tires & Auto Repair Shop
Tire Retailer | Pell City, AL | City Tire Inc
Tire Retailer | Pell City, AL | City Tire Inc

Related Post